Better than expected GDP numbers by China: 5 metal stocks with an upside potential of up to 25% - 8 days ago
The fact that China had been making one after another attempt to bring its economy back on track and did not meet with immediate success led to an impression that things will not improve for the metal sector anytime soon. But on Tuesday, when the GDP numbers came out, they were better than expected, against the expected 4.8 % the numbers came at 5.3 % for the first quarter. While this is a quarter number so there can be some skepticism the fact is that over the last two decades, there have been many issues that the Chinese economy has faced, right from debt to GDP concern to shadow banking to property crisis. They all have been resolved and the economy has been able to make a comeback. So, don't dismiss these numbers. The biggest impact of a sustained Chinese recovery would be felt by one sector, that is metals and probably the street has a hint of it and that is why metal stocks can outperform even in volatile markets.

Getting back into shape for good? Banking stocks with upside potential of more than 20% - 8 days ago
One sector where the street has been giving differential treatment for many years has been the banking space. Right from PSU banks to small finance banks to private sector banks and even in the private sector banks, there has been a different treatment to different sets of banks. But recently the divergence in valuation has been narrowing down, at all levels. Whether it is between private and public sector banks or even intra private banks segments. There are two underlying factors for it, first, over the years, technology which was a strong point of large private sector banks has been to an extent implemented by other banks also. Second, different banks take care of different segments of the economy, some retail, some large corporate, some SME and retail. So when all segments of the economy are doing well, there is a greater likelihood that all banks will see better performance. Why the dollar is causing chaos in emerging markets - 9 days ago
Emerging-market (EM) currencies have tumbled this year as the dollar has gone from strength to strength. Taiwan’s currency dropped to the lowest level in almost 8 years this week, India’s rupee slumped to a record, and Malaysia’s ringgit is close to the weakest since the Asian financial crisis in 1998. All except one of the 23 main developing-nation currencies tracked by Bloomberg have fallen against the greenback this year.
